At least 40,000 Web sites recently were hacked and retrofitted with instructions that silently attempt to infest visitor PCs with malicious software, security experts warn. Internet security firm Websense has dubbed this series of attacks “Beladen,” because the infected sites divert visitors to a site called beladen.net — one of at least two exploit domains [...]
